Yorkshire Terriers have a large personality and are the perfect lap dog. They are fearless and brave, regardless of their size. This makes them great watchdogs as well as supreme micers.

There are no reputable breeders who produce Yorkshire Terriers that are smaller than the standard size. Teacup, micro and miniature are terms used to describe breeds marketed by unethical breeders.

Because of their small size, Yorkies can be easy to hurt by slipping on or laying on them. This is the most common reason for visits to the veterinarian particularly for puppies. They are also susceptible to hypoglycemia as well as patellar displacement (kneecap dislocation) that can occur when the kneecap moves from its normal position.

As with any dog there is a chance that your Yorkie may develop health issues throughout their life. Yorkies are smaller than other breeds, which means these ailments are more difficult to identify and treat. For instance, their small blood vessels could make it difficult to conduct tests for blood and other procedures on them, and they might not be able to respond to dosages of medication that are designed for larger dogs.

A small mouth and teeth make them more prone to disease. To avoid developing disease and keep your dog healthy, it's essential to brush your dog's teeth every day with a pet-specific toothpaste.

Yorkshire Terriers are generally healthy however, as with all breeds, they're susceptible to certain conditions and diseases. They can develop liver shunts (a condition in which blood sugar is low) cataracts, hypoglycemia, cataracts and musculoskeletal issues.

A balanced diet, proper training and vet care, enrichment and plenty of opportunities to chase squeaky mouses are crucial to allowing your Yorkie to live a long, healthy and fulfilled life.

Sometimes, the smallest dogs and some Yorkies are affected by a condition called Legg-Calve-Perthes (LCP). The femoral heads of the hip bones are brittle and they are susceptible to breaking because there is reduced blood flow to the region. LCP can cause discomfort in the rear legs and may require surgery.

Heart disease is a different health concern. Yorkies and other breeds of toy are at a higher risk of cardiovascular disease because of their small bodies. A high-quality diet consisting of low-fat meat and vegetables may help reduce their risk.

Yorkies are affectionate, but also stubborn and independent. They require a pet owner who is patient and persevering throughout their training. Early socialization is essential to avoid excessive barking and also aversion to strangers. It is important to teach your dog how to walk on a lead and stop barking.
